Wünsche y Sugerencias | | | | Jörg Sellmeyer | Yo sería me wünschen, dass Parametertrenner einheitlich verwendet voluntad. Also no Minus mehr en verschiedenen Ventana- oder auch Zeichenbefehlen, pero stattdessen einheitlich Kommas como Trenner. Auch el Semikolon podría mejor ersetzt voluntad. |
| | | Windows XP SP2 XProfan X4... und hier mal was ganz anderes als Profan ... | 19.08.2016 ▲ |
| |
| | RGH | Aus Kompatibilitätsgründen es por desgracia, no posible. Und sería Yo beides erlauben, sería el Parser sólo unübersichtlicher, langsamer y fehleranfälliger!
Saludo Roland |
| | | XProfan X3Intel Duo E8400 3,0 GHz / 4 GB RAM / 1000 GB HDD - ATI Radeon HD 4770 512 MB - Windows 7 Home Premium 32Bit - XProfan X4 | 19.08.2016 ▲ |
| |
| | Jörg Sellmeyer | Naja - Yo hatte como auch más a una mittel- a langfristige Solución pensamiento. Also Ankündigung ahora y Umsetzung entonces con X15 oder X16. Bis dahin hätte cada genug Tiempo, seine Codes veces durchzuforsten. |
| | | Windows XP SP2 XProfan X4... und hier mal was ganz anderes als Profan ... | 19.08.2016 ▲ |
| |
| | RGH | Sorry, Yo wohl en meiner Antwort a kurz pensamiento:
Yo habe me el Sache una vez más genauer a geschaut! Es offensichtlich alles viel einfacher, como Yo en el ersten Moment pensamiento: Für el allermeisten Befehle puede ya ahora el Parámetro-Trenner "=", ";" y ">" (otro kommen neben el Komma sí no antes) por una Komma ersetzt voluntad, como el Komma sí a la el Signo gehört, el grundsätzlich el Ende uno Parámetros Mostrar. (Es eigentlich ya seit Jahren.)
Excepción, el Yo ändern debería: WINDOW - Das "-" se como Kennzeichen genutzt, dass lo 4 Parámetro son y no sólo zwei. Das kann Yo aber vermutlich ligeramente ändern.
Ausnahmen, el auch así bleiben debería: PLAY - hier trennt el Komma el Töne el Folge, el Semikolon el Stimmen uno Tons PRINT - beim Semikolon voluntad el Ausdrücke direkt hintereinander ausgegeben, beim Komma se una Leerzeichen eingefügt
En el Zuweisungen a una Bereichsvariable con BYTE, CHAR, LONG, etc. es el "=" natürlich sinnvoll, como lo sí una Zuweisung es. (Tatsächlich kann lo aber auch hier por una "," ersetzt voluntad.)
En CLASS y STRUCT debería el "=" natürlich weiterhin zwingend erforderlich bleiben, como se trata de un Definition es.
En MAT es lo beim Trennzeichen zwischen el Parametern tatsächlich en una Operator, así dass hier sólo "=", "+", "-", "/" oder "*" erlaubt son y bleiben.
Kurz: Lediglich WINDOW bedarf uno Überarbeitung!
Saludo Roland |
| | | Intel Duo E8400 3,0 GHz / 4 GB RAM / 1000 GB HDD - ATI Radeon HD 4770 512 MB - Windows 7 Home Premium 32Bit - XProfan X4 | 19.08.2016 ▲ |
| |
| | Jörg Sellmeyer | Super - Hartnäckigkeit zahlt se eben doch de Tome el Hilo doch simplemente en deine ToDo-Liste en. Wenn lo entonces instalado es, könntest du lo hier direkt en hecho conjunto. Yo sería sowieso esta ganzen Wünsche-Zona gerne veces algo aufräumen, así uno veces otra vez weiß, weas eigentlich ya hecho es, qué todavía ansteht y qué no umsetzbar es. Tiempo sehen, wann David veces otra vez reinschneit. |
| | | | |
| | RGH | Hecho: Im nächsten Bugfix o, el nächsten Versión (X3.1a oder X3.2) puede ser entonces auch beim Windows-Befehl el "-" por una "," sustituir. Como aber siempre todavía el "-" erlaubt es, muss en el Zweifelsfall una Ausdruck con "-" en el zweiten Parámetro geklammert voluntad ... como bisher.
Saludo Roland |
| | | XProfan X3Intel Duo E8400 3,0 GHz / 4 GB RAM / 1000 GB HDD - ATI Radeon HD 4770 512 MB - Windows 7 Home Premium 32Bit - XProfan X4 | 19.08.2016 ▲ |
| |
| | Michael W. | Como gibt's sí inzwischen etliches a Beachten en el Syntax.
Cuestión: Funktioniert en CaseOf auch el neue !=
y
Quad B,A = N1 [,N2 [...]]// el fehlt desafortunadamente (y ser Gegenstück)
.Super.{methode}(...) AddFiles [*]S Arc X1,Y1 - X2,Y2; X3,Y3; X4,Y4 Array( Typ$ E1 [,En...]) // kein Trenner zw. Typ y Werten Byte B,A = N1 [,N2 [...]] Case {bedingung} : {befehl} Casenote {bedingung} : {befehl} CaseOf T1 [,T2 [...]] // <,<=,>,>=,<> UND DIE FRAGE: != (como neuer Operator) auch erlaubt??? Char B,A = S1 [,S2 [...]] Chord X1,Y1 - X2,Y2; X3,Y3; X4,Y4 Class {name} = [g1]E1 [,[g2]E2 [...]] Copy S1 > S2 CopyBmp X1,Y1 - X2,Y2 > X3,Y3; N1 [,N2] CopyBmpToMem X1,Y1 - DX,DY > X2,Y2 CopyPic H,X1,Y1 - X2,Y2 > X3,Y3; N1 [,N2] CopySizedBmp X1,Y1 - X2,Y2 > X3,Y3 - X4,Y4; N CopySizedPic H,X1,Y1 - X2,Y2 > X3,Y3 - X4,Y4; N db("Go" , X [,N]) // [ |<, >|, <, >, * ] DrawExtBmp I,S,X,Y; N DrawPic /**/ H,X,Y; N1 [,N2] /**/ S,X,Y; N1 [,N2] /**/ I,S,X,Y; N1 [,N2] DrawSizedExtBmp I,S,X1,Y1 - X2,Y2; N DrawSizedPic /**/ H,X,Y - DX,DY; N /**/ S,X,Y - DX,DY; N /**/ I,S,X,Y - DX,DY; N DrawText /**/ X,Y,S[,N] /**/ X1,Y1,X2,Y2,S,N Ellipse X1,Y1 - X2,Y2 Float B,A = N1 [,N2 [...]] If( {bedingung}, {True-Valor}, {False-Valor}) LoadBmp S,X,Y;N LoadSizedBmp S,X1,Y1 - X2,Y2;N Largo B,A = N [,N[...]] MCopyBmp X1,Y1 - X2,Y2 > X3,Y3; N1 [,N2] MCopySizedBmp X1,Y1 - X2,Y2 > X3,Y3 - X4,Y4; N Ratón( X1,Y1 - X2,Y2) // !!! Minus en Funktionsparametern oGL("2D" ,X,Y,Z,vSX,vSY) // Referenz-Parámetro: vSX,vSY Pie X1,Y1 - X2,Y2; X3,Y3; X4,Y4 Play N1[ ;N2 [...;N16]] ,T,P Imprimir /**/ f;f,f ... /**/ #N,f;f,f ... Rectángulo X1,Y1 - X2,Y2 RoundRect X1,Y1 - X2,Y2; X3,Y3 SaveBmp S,X1,Y1 - X2,Y2 SaveBmpToClip X1,Y1 - DX1,DY1 ScreenCopy [X1,Y1 - X2,Y2] String B,A = S [,S[...]] StringW B,A = S [,S[...]] // alt Struct {Name} = E1 [,E2 [...]] SubProc {ContainerFunc}.{Unterfunktion} TBox X1,Y1 - X2,Y2; N TMouse( X1,Y1 - X2,Y2) // !!! Minus en Funktionsparametern WideChar B,A = WS [,WS[...]] WideString B,A = WS [,WS[...]] Ventana [X1,Y1 - ] X2,Y2 Word B,A = N[,N[...]] WriteIni S1,S2,S3=S4 Funktionieren en STRUCT y CLASS el neuen Datentypen ???
|
| | | System: Windows 8/10, XProfan X4 Programmieren, das spannendste Detektivspiel der Welt. | 21.08.2016 ▲ |
| |
| | RGH | Nein, en CaseOf funktioniert el "!=" no.
En Ratón() y TMouse() puede ser ya (fast) siempre el "-" duch una "," sustituir.
QUAD fehlt tatsächlich todavía. Das debería aber kein Problema ser, el einzubauen.
In Estructuras y Klassen son el neuen Datentypen erlaubt, como ellos en el Ayuda bajo 7.5 y 7.6 posición: && y %% (Yo habe gerade gesehen: In el Referenz muss Yo ellos todavía nachtragen.)
Saludo Roland |
| | | XProfan X3Intel Duo E8400 3,0 GHz / 4 GB RAM / 1000 GB HDD - ATI Radeon HD 4770 512 MB - Windows 7 Home Premium 32Bit - XProfan X4 | 21.08.2016 ▲ |
| |
|
RespuestaTema opciones | 10.314 Views |
ThemeninformationenDieses Thema ha 3 subscriber: |